 Sammy Gyamfi Accuses NPP, Government Of Buying Votes Ahead Of Assin North By-Election

Sammy Gyamfi, the National Communications Officer for the opposition National Democratic Congress (NDC), has accused the NPP government of vote-buying ahead of the by-election in Assin North, which is scheduled to take place on Tuesday, June 27, 2023.

He claims the government is using fertiliser and knapsack sprayers purchased with taxpayer money to try to buy votes in the Assin North constituency.

Sammy Gyamfi stated that shipment was en route to Ningo, Gangan, Ayittey, and other NDC strongholds in the constituency.

He said that prominent NPP members like Stephen Ntim (national chairman) and Justin Kodua (general secretary) are in charge of the group. Mr. Gyamfi produced evidence that the Akufo-Addo/Bawumia/NPP government is misusing public resources to fund electoral campaigns.

In an unanimous verdict, the Supreme Court ruled that James Gyakye Quayson’s membership in Parliament should be revoked. The election of Gyakye Quayson as Member of Parliament for Assin North was ruled unlawful on Wednesday, May 17, 2023, because he held dual citizenship at the time he applied to run in the 2020 elections.

After the Cape Coast High Court rejected Michael Ankomah Nimfa’s victory as the MP for Assin North in July 2021, Assin Bereku resident Michael Ankomah Nimfa took Quayson to court to prevent him from continuing to act in that capacity.
